Transaction 2c878d2791e62cc5de6ad078f95c2d9b3668697e70c8959a813060269a30206e

1 Input
2 Outputs
  • 2c878d2791e62cc5de6ad078f95c2d9b3668697e70c8959a813060269a30206e:0
  • value  1039969420
    address  32A7hZwXxGbcGxavcvyu96xTqumQaWz1XP
  • 2c878d2791e62cc5de6ad078f95c2d9b3668697e70c8959a813060269a30206e:1
  • value  740000000
    address  386VjSqv8f4sEhjKzLXthRfbjTFSRHg7EK